This job assumes responsibility for and provides routine treatment as assigned according to plan of are provided by a licensed Occupational Therapist. Provides direct patient care after the patient has been evaluated by a licensed Occupational Therapist and documents patient progress in daily progress notes and/or summaries to physicians.

Education

Required – Associate’s degree from an accredited occupational therapy assistant program

Work Experience

Required – None.

Certifications

Required – Eligibility for state Occupational Therapy Assistant licensure by examination , current state license . prior to start date

Basic Life Support (BLS) from the American Heart Association

Preferred- Current Louisiana Occupational Therapy Assistant license

Job Duties

  • Achieves established productivity levels set forth by administration.
  • Adapts behavior to the specific patient population, including but not limited to: respect for privacy, method of introduction to the patient, adapting explanation of services or procedures to be performed, requesting permissions and communication style.
  • May be required to educate and train others within discipline.
  • Other related duties as required.
  • Participates in staff and committee projects.
  • Maintains patient records according to documentation standards, policies and procedures.
  • Communicates and documents any changes in patient’s status and informs therapist of patient’s reassessment.
  • Performs occupational therapy treatments as prescribed by the physician under the supervision of a licensed occupational therapist.

Physical and Environmental Demands
The physical essential functions of this job include (but are not limited to) the following: Frequently exerting 10 to 20 pounds of force to move objects; occasionally exerting up to 100 pounds of force. Physical demand requirements are in excess of those for sedentary work.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ions

Mechanical lifting devices (e.g. carts, dollies, etc.) or team lifts should be utilized.
Must be able to stoop, bend, reach, squat, crawl and grab with arms and hands, manual dexterity.
Must be able to travel throughout and between facilities.

Duties performed routinely require exposure to blood, body fluid and tissue.

The incumbent works in a patient care area; works in an area where patients enter; works directly with patients; and/or works with specimens that could contain diseases. There may be an occupational risk for exposure to all communicable diseases.

Because the incumbent works within a healthcare setting, there may be occupational risk for exposure to hazardous medications or hazardous waste within the environment through receipt, transport, storage, preparation, dispensing, administration, cleaning and/or disposal of contaminated waste. The risk level of exposure may increase depending on the essential job duties of the role.
